1. Chubb
With its long-standing reputation in the insurance industry, Chubb is a top choice for insuring fine art and valuable collectibles. Chubb offers specialized coverage for high-net-worth individuals, including tailored policies for art collectors, galleries, museums, and dealers. Their fine art insurance policies are designed to protect against a wide range of risks, such as accidental damage, theft, and natural disasters. Chubb also provides appraisal services and risk management advice to help clients safeguard their art investments.
2. AXA Art
As a leading insurer of fine art worldwide, AXA Art is known for its expertise in providing customized insurance solutions for art collectors and cultural institutions. AXA Art offers flexible coverage options for individual artworks, collections, exhibitions, and transit. Their policies also include coverage for restoration and conservation costs, as well as legal expenses related to art disputes. With a team of art experts and claims specialists, AXA Art provides top-notch service and support to clients in the art industry.
3. Hiscox
Hiscox is a renowned insurer that offers specialized insurance products for fine art, jewelry, and other valuable possessions. Hiscox’s fine art insurance policies are tailored to meet the unique needs of art collectors, dealers, and galleries. Their coverage includes protection against risks like fire, theft, damage, and loss during transit. Hiscox also provides access to a network of restoration professionals and art advisors to help clients preserve and protect their art collections.
4. Berkley Asset Protection
Berkley Asset Protection is another top choice for insuring fine art and valuable assets. With a focus on high-value collections, Berkley offers comprehensive insurance solutions to protect artworks, antiques, and luxury items. Their fine art policies cover a wide range of risks, including accidental damage, theft, and mysterious disappearance. Berkley also offers risk management services and valuation assistance to help clients assess the value of their art collections accurately.
5. Travelers
Travelers Insurance is a trusted provider of fine art insurance for collectors, galleries, and museums. Travelers’ fine art policies offer broad coverage for a variety of risks, including accidental damage, theft, and natural disasters. Their specialized art insurance also includes coverage for transit, temporary exhibitions, and restoration costs. Additionally, Travelers provides expert appraisals and risk assessment services to help clients protect their art investments effectively.
